What is a Split Air to Water Heat Pump?

A split air to water heat pump operates by extracting heat from the outside air. It uses a refrigerant to absorb heat, which is then transferred to water. This process makes it an efficient choice, especially in mild climates. These systems are divided into two parts: an outdoor unit that captures air and an indoor unit that distributes heat.

Benefits of Using a Split Air to Water Heat Pump

Energy Efficiency

One of the standout features of a split air to water heat pump is its energy efficiency. These systems can produce three to four units of heat for every unit of electricity consumed. This translates to lower energy bills and a reduced carbon footprint.

Environmentally Friendly

Using a split air to water heat pump is an eco-conscious choice. It reduces reliance on fossil fuels, lowering greenhouse gas emissions. As the world shifts toward greener energy solutions, adopting this technology is a proactive step.

Versatility

Split air to water heat pumps are versatile. They can supply heating, cooling, and hot water for various applications. This adaptability makes them suitable for residential and commercial properties.

Installation and Maintenance

Installation Process

Installing a split air to water heat pump requires professional expertise. It's essential to evaluate your property’s heating needs to choose the right unit. The outdoor unit will be placed in an area with adequate airflow, while the indoor unit connects to your heating system and hot water supply.

Maintenance Requirements

Regular maintenance ensures optimal performance. Homeowners should schedule annual inspections to check refrigerant levels and clean component filters. Simple tasks like cleaning the outdoor unit can enhance efficiency and longevity.

Cost Considerations

Initial Investment

The upfront cost of installing a split air to water heat pump can be higher than traditional systems. However, the long-term savings on energy bills often outweigh this initial expense. Many governments offer incentives for energy-efficient upgrades, which can further reduce costs.

Long-term Savings

Considering the energy savings and potential incentives, a split air to water heat pump can be a wise investment. Over time, homeowners can recoup the costs through lower energy bills. Additionally, these systems require less maintenance compared to traditional heating methods.

Potential Drawbacks

Climate Limitations

While split air to water heat pumps are effective, their efficiency may decrease in extremely cold climates. However, modern versions are designed to operate efficiently even in lower temperatures. Homeowners in such areas should consider models specifically designed for colder climates.

Installation Complexity

The complexity of installation can vary. While it's manageable for professionals, it requires careful planning and execution. Thus, finding a qualified installer is crucial.
